Miriam be strong and fight fight fight. Happy to meet you! You must walk through this. I was diagnosed with appendix cancer and gaucher disease in 2002. I had a right hemicolectomy. At that time the mass was taken, appendix, secum, and some intestine. I was diagnosed with stage 3. Went through chemo and radiation all at Ireland Cancer Center at University
Hospital Main Campus, in Cleveland Ohio. It will be 10 years in May. I had wonderful care and loved and respected my do...</description>
